TSA pat-down leaves traveler covered in urine
'I was absolutely humiliated,' said bladder cancer survivor

A retired special education teacher on his way to a wedding in Orlando, Fla., said he was left humiliated, crying and covered with his own urine after an enhanced pat-down by TSA officers recently at Detroit Metropolitan Airport.
“I was absolutely humiliated, I couldn’t even speak,” said Thomas D. “Tom” Sawyer, 61, of Lansing, Mich.
Sawyer is a bladder cancer survivor who now wears a urostomy bag, which collects his urine from a stoma, or opening in his stomach. “I have to wear special clothes and in order to mount the bag I have to seal a wafer to my stomach and then attach the bag. If the seal is broken, urine can leak all over my body and clothes.”
A longtime Charlotte, N.C., flight attendant and cancer survivor told a local television station that she was forced to show her prosthetic breast during a pat-down.
Cathy Bossi, who works for U.S. Airways, said she received the pat-down after declining to do the full-body scan because of radiation concerns.
The TSA screener "put her full hand on my breast and said, 'What is this?' " Bossi told the station. "And I said, 'It's my prosthesis because I've had breast cancer.' And she said, 'Well, you'll need to show me that.' "
Bossi said she removed the prosthetic from her bra. She did not take the name of the agent, she said, "because it was just so horrific of an experience, I couldn't believe someone had done that to me. I'm a flight attendant. I was just trying to get to work."

Man claims Charlotte TSA employee groped his 6-year-old son
By Brigida Mack - bio l email & Tom Roussey - bio l email
CHARLOTTE, N.C. (WBTV) - Are children exempt for pat-downs at airport security? Not according to one man who says a TSA employee groped 6 year-old son at Charlotte Douglas International Airport.
The alleged incident is part of the growing backlash over the full body scans and pat downs at airports nationwide.
WBTV found the anonymous submission on a blog, "We Won't Fly." The man says the incident happened earlier this month and he describes how his little boy was traumatized saying the TSA agent groped his groin and that the little boy left the checkpoint in tears.
The commenter says his son was aggressively patted down by a TSA employee.
"He was pleading for me to help him and I was admonished for trying to comfort him," the comment on the blog states. "His genitals area was groped. He walked down to the plane in tears."

"We were not given the choice of a full body scanner, but would have preferred it over this humiliating experience," the comment continues. "The scanners are still intrusive, but at least my 6-year-old son would have been unaware of the intrusion."
Controversial TSA Pat Down Leaves 3 Year Old Girl in Tears
It's a video that tens of thousands of people have viewed on YouTube; A three-year-old sobbing and screaming "stop touching me" during a TSA pat down at the Chattanoona,Tennessee airport. The child's TV reporter father captured the incident on his mobile phone. Now, it's raising questions about how children should be screened at airports.
